  • August De Wilde (2 June 1819 – 7 October 1886) was a Belgian painter. He was born on 2 June 1819 in Lokeren and moved to Sint-Niklaas with his parents in 1833. He completed his studies at the local drawing school, graduating with acclamation. He continued his studies at the Antwerp Academy. There, he also distinguished himself. He moved to Antwerp and in 1851 he replaced Jan De Loose as director of the drawing school of Sint-Niklaas. Many paintings by this artist are known. These include domestic scenes, portraits, and altarpieces. The works of De Wilde could be found for example in the hall of the town hall of Sint-Niklaas (H.M. de Koningen, after Gallait), and in the place of prayer of the choristers of the abbey of Rozendaal, in Waasmunster (O.L. Vrouw, te midden van engelen). He won the 1870 Dunkirk painting competition with the painting Love in the Moonlight (De liefde in den mooneschijn). (en)
  • Auguste de Wilde (* 2. Juni 1819 in Lokeren; † 7. Oktober 1886 in Saint-Nicolas) war ein belgischer Porträt-, Genre- und Historienmaler. Auguste de Wilde war Schüler der Akademie der bildenden Künste von Saint-Nicolas und der Koninklijke Academie voor Schone Kunsten van Antwerpen unter Gustave Wappers. Nach dem Studium kehrte er nach Saint-Nicolas zurück. 1851 wurde er zum Direktor der Akademie von Saint-Nicolas berufen. Er malte Porträts, Historien- und Genreszenen. * Szene aus dem Familienleben * Marie Henriette von Österreich * Gestohlen Eitelkeit * Les Arlesiennes (de)
